Ignore:
Timestamp:
05/02/07 22:31:31 (17 years ago)
Author:
r2d
Message:
  • added some checks in sv8 demuxing
  • corrected a bug in mpc2sv8
File:
1 edited

Legend:

Unmodified
Added
Removed
  • libmpc/trunk/mpc2sv8/mpc2sv8.c

    r297 r302  
    177177
    178178        // copy end of file
    179         stream_size = (((mpc_demux_pos(demux) + 7) >> 3) - si.header_position + 3) & ~3;
     179
     180        stream_size = (((mpc_demux_pos(demux) + 7 - 20) >> 3) - si.header_position + 3) & ~3;
    180181        fseek(in_file, si.header_position + stream_size, SEEK_SET);
    181182        while((r_size = fread(buf, 1, TMP_BUF_SIZE, in_file))) {
Note: See TracChangeset for help on using the changeset viewer.